Caverta is a brand of sildenafil that helps treat erectile dysfunction.

If you want clear, practical info—how it works, how to use it safely, and buying tips—you picked the right page. Sildenafil relaxes blood vessels in the penis so blood flow increases during sexual arousal. That makes erections easier to achieve and keep for many men. Caverta usually starts working within thirty to sixty minutes and its effects can last up to four hours, but responses vary.

Start with a low dose. Doctors often recommend fifty milligrams as a starting point, but your health, age, and other medicines may mean you should use twenty five or one hundred milligrams instead. Take Caverta on an empty stomach for faster action; a heavy meal can slow absorption. Do not take it more than once every twenty four hours. If you have heart disease, low blood pressure, or use nitrate drugs, avoid sildenafil completely and talk to your doctor.

Interactions matter

Sildenafil can interact with alpha blockers, some antifungal drugs, certain antibiotics, and HIV protease inhibitors. Always tell your prescriber about all medicines, herbal supplements, and even recreational drugs you use. Alcohol in large amounts can reduce effectiveness and increase side effects.

Expect some common side effects: headache, flushing, nasal congestion, indigestion, and dizziness. These tend to be mild and short lived. Seek immediate medical help if you experience chest pain, sudden vision loss, or a painful erection lasting more than four hours. Those are rare but serious signals you must not ignore.

Travel or special situations? Store Caverta at room temperature away from moisture and heat. If you miss a dose, do not double up; follow the once-a-day rule. For men with kidney or liver problems, doctors may alter the dose. Younger men and healthy individuals may tolerate standard dosing, but personal factors always matter.
